how to calculate change in concentration
To calculate the change in concentration, you need to subtract the initial concentration from the final concentration. The formula is:
Change in concentration = Final concentration - Initial concentration
For example, if the initial concentration of a substance is 0.2 M and the final concentration is 0.5 M, the change in concentration would be:
Change in concentration = 0.5 M - 0.2 M
Change in concentration = 0.3 M
